Top of the section is the 1.2.1 RLS template defect Task 4 found. That
template bound the write-side policy to app.tenant_id, but PostgresRecorder
writes every tenant through one pool and never calls set_config, so every
INSERT is rejected — and telemetry degrades silently, so the symptom is an
empty table, not an error. The entry says how to check for it (count rows
with a BYPASSRLS role; grep the per-row write warning) and what the new
WITH CHECK (true) template trades away.

PostgreSQL checks the schema CREATE privilege before the IF NOT EXISTS
existence test, so an account with only table-level INSERT was denied on
CREATE TABLE IF NOT EXISTS even though the table was right there and
writable. The denial set _failed and the whole recorder went no-op for
the process lifetime, silently: 150+ calls downstream lost their latency,
token and cost rows with nothing but one warning to show for it.
The probe is the direct fix. The larger fix is the criterion: structural
degradation now means "provably cannot write" (pool creation failed, or
the table is absent and cannot be created), not "something threw during
init" -- a probe or acquire failure just skips the row and retries on the
next call.
SQLite stays as it is on purpose. Measured: it short-circuits the
statement at parse time, so it passes even under another connection's
EXCLUSIVE lock or on a read-only file. A probe there would buy nothing;
the docstring now says so to keep symmetry-minded future edits away.

Independent verification found the first cut had swapped one bug for a
worse one. The budgets were split by "did we send a request", so a 429
attempt counted as productive — but 429 is exempt from the retry budget,
so its time burned neither budget. Against a queueing gateway that holds
the request for the full timeout before answering 429, a call could hang
for 301 attempts / 25.2 hours, measured, versus 301 seconds before the
change.
The split is now by which budget the time consumes: time that burns
max_attempts is excluded from stall, time that does not (429 attempts
included) belongs to stall. Measured again: back to one attempt / 301s.
Only the chat loop needs this — embedding and ocr count 429 against
max_attempts unconditionally, so the gap never existed there. The stall
verdict moved into _stalled(), which both call sites had duplicated, to
keep __call__ under the complexity gate.
